Undergraduate Tuition & Fees

The following table compares 2023-2024 undergraduate tuition & fees between selected colleges. The average undergraduate tuition & fees is $50,944 for all students. The 2023-2024 undergraduate tuition & fees of selected colleges are increased by 4.19% compared to the previous year.
Among the selected colleges, Amherst College requires the most expensive tuition & fees of $67,280 and Boston Graduate School of Psychoanalysis Inc has the lowest tuition & fees of $21,504 for undergraduate programs.
Undergraduate Tuition & Fess Comparison Between Selected Colleges
Name2022-20232023-2024
In-StateOut-of-StateIn-StateOut-of-State
Suffolk University $43,332$45,380
Fisher College $34,150$35,013
Boston Graduate School of Psychoanalysis Inc This school does not have undergraduate programs.
Bentley University $56,500$58,150
Amherst College $64,100$67,280
Northeastern University Professional Programs $46,397$48,899
Average$48,896$50,944
